China Criticizes U.S. Over 104% Tariffs, Pledges to Protect Its Interests

China has strongly criticized the U.S. for placing a 104% tariff on Chinese products. A spokesperson from China’s Foreign Ministry stated that the country will stand firm and defend its national interests. China accused the U.S. of using pressure tactics and said such actions won’t stop China’s progress.

“The Chinese people don’t look for trouble,” the spokesperson said, “but we won’t step back when faced with threats. We will firmly protect our sovereignty, security, and development goals. If the U.S. truly wants dialogue, it must act with respect and fairness. If it chooses a trade war instead, we will respond with strength.”
